On an island off the coast of chile, captain amaso delano, sailing an american sealer, sees the san dominick, a spanish slave ship, in obvious distress. Based on a true story, herman melville s 1855 novella benito cereno follows american captain amasa delano s discovery of a ship he first believes to be in distress before realizing, over the course of the same day, that a slave revolt has taken place on it. Benito cereno is a novella by herman melville, a fictionalized account about the revolt on a spanish slave ship captained by don benito cereno, first published in three installments in putnams monthly in 1855. The story which ends with a haunting twist centers on a slave rebellion aboard a spanish merchant ship in 1799 and because of its ambiguity has been read by some as racist and proslavery and by others as antiracist.
